Please take the time to read and understand what it is trying to do. It is there to help you and not hinder you. It is compulsary so you will have to implement it anyway, why not get some benefit from it?

If you are running a small company, your SMS only needs to be a small document.

It is not something that has been thought of recently. This has been in use in the Nuclear and Oil industries for years, we know it will improve safety and reduce costs if used correctly.

A little advice for when you write yours, remember this is about saving lives NOT trailing extension leads and paper cuts.

Keep it simple.
